Numotion Acquires Barnes Healthcare Custom Mobility Division
- By Laurie Watanabe
- Dec 18, 2013
Numotion has acquired the custom mobility division of Barnes Healthcare Services, which has offices in Alabama, Florida and Georgia, and serves pediatric and adult clients with complex seating & positioning needs.
In announcing the change, Barnes Healthcare CEO Charlie Barnes III said, "Barnes Healthcare Services has been providing various healthcare services to customers in the southeast region for more than 104 years. The sale of our custom mobility division allows us to position ourselves for the future and focus on other service lines, including pharmacy, respiratory services, nutrition and medical supplies, as well as develop programs that align with the current and future healthcare environments."
"We are excited about the professional team at Barnes joining Numotion, as they have a strong reputation in customer service," Numotion's regional VP Bill Boyce said in the news statement. "The addition of Barnes' seven locations in Georgia and Florida greatly expands our coverage and improves access to complex rehab technology to residents throughout the region."
